Processes involued in the morphodynamics evolution of Roberts Bank (Fraser Delta) (hydrodynamic and sedimentary in situ observation and modelling)

Sous la pression anthropique et la modification du régime sédimentaire, la plage de sable fin de Roberts Bank (Delta du Fraser, Canada) est soumise à une érosion significative. Des périodes de mesures et de modélisation ont permis d identifier les processus hydrodynamiques et sédimentaires associés aux courants de marée et à la houle. A marée montante, les structures sédimentaires, en haut de pente deltaïque, fournissent une rugosité de fond qui favorise la remise en suspension des sédiments. A marée descendante, les sédiments sont transportés vers le large par un panache de surface et par les chenaux. Un processus dit de "mixing-induced convective sedimentation" accélèrent alors le dépôt. L'incidence des vagues de tempêtes, la morphologie et le marnage vont influer sur une divergence du transport sédimentaire. Celui-ci est à la côte à marée haute, et vers le large à marée basse. La surcote de tempête participe avec les courants de jusant et d'arrachement à un transport vers le large.
